This MOOC presents the services and the architecture of 5G networks, the main principles of the new radio interface (NR), data flow management, security and the new Service-Based Architecture (SBA).
In recent years, operators have been deploying 5G technology on commercial mobile networks. The latter is announced as a major technological breakthrough with speeds beyond Gbit/s, very low latencies and above all a distribution in many sectors of activity (industry, transport, medicine, etc.). Beyond the announcement effects, this technology relies heavily on 4G. The waveform for radio transmission is identical, the management of data flows is similar. However, 5G significantly extends the possible options both in the choice of architectures and in the radio interface configurations as well as in the security mechanisms. All this is explained in the mooc. A certificate of successful completion is awarded by Coursera to learners who succeed in obtaining a mark greater than 50%. Institut Mines-Télécom is a public institution dedicated to higher education, research and innovation in engineering and digital technologies. Always attentive to the economic world, IMT combines strong academic legitimacy, close corporate relations. It focuses on key transformations in Digital Technologies, Production, Energy and Ecology and trains the engineers, managers and PhDs who will be tomorrow’s players in these key changes of the 21st century. Its activities are conducted in Mines and Télécom graduate schools under the aegis of the Minister for Industry and Electronic Communication, one subsidiary school and three strategic partners. The IMT’s schools rank among the leading graduate schools in France.
